What is the Southern Downs Youth Council?

Southern Downs Regional Council is committed to proactively involving young people in the future of our community through consultation and decision-making processes.

The Southern Downs Youth Council (SDYC) was established as an advisory committee whose role is to represent the voice of young people who live, work, study or volunteer in the Southern Downs region, to provide input into Council activities and decisions.

Purpose

The SDYC program aids to provide young people with opportunities to:

  •  Develop a better understanding of the role and function of local government, our community and local issues;
  • 'Have a voice' - raise issues, exchange ideas, discuss community issues, provide input into Council planning, programs, services and influence local government decision making processes; and
  • Have genuine and regular communication about issues that are important to them directly with the Mayor and Council Officers.
